Call for artists, Art fluent contest, Boston USA
THEME
TRUE BLUE- The color blue is the most universally appealing color on the spectrum. It can represent trust, loyalty, wisdom, confidence, and sensitivity. But it can also convey fragility, depression, impersonality, and even coldness. There was a time when the pigment blue was the rarest and most precious shade of all. Some artists even went into debt just to use the color! With so many intriguing shades of blue to work and so many meanings and representations, show us TRUE BLUE through your perspective.

Surveillance Society. A State of Control
SURVEILLANCE SOCIETY. A STATE OF CONTROL
Call for Exhibition │Free entry
Accepted media: Photography, Digital Visual Design, Video
Group Exhibition in Rome or Milan city. April 2022
This call intends to collect works that are useful while critically commenting on contemporary society and on the tools used to regulate the behavior of the masses.
“A state of control”, this is how the condition of men who live within the spaces of an evolved society can be defined. More and more technologies are being used to guarantee the safety of individuals, in an attitude of trust towards those who have the task of nipping in the bud the emergence of behaviors not recognized by social norms.
Surveillance also means recording, analyzing behaviors and lifestyles, it means collecting data and information useful for the growth of a nation, for the protection and safety of one’s people, but also and above all, useful to those who know how to make economic profit out of all this.
It is here that, once again, that vision of the world made known by G. Orwel in his novel “1984” is called into question, where contemplation on human rights and freedoms are at the center of a conscious criticism of the social system and of an idea about the future.
